List and describe three specific ways that the American West benefitted from the Civil War after the Reconstruction?

Three particular means by which the American West benefited from the after effects of the Civil War are :-

  • Native American Treaties
  • Homestead Act
  • Construction of the Transcontinental Railroad

Homestead Act

A group of laws prevailing in US, where a person who is applying under any of these laws, was able to attain public land under the ownership of government is called The Homestead Acts. This public land is called homestead. It was signed by Sir Abraham Lincoln in the year 1862. This Act increases the migration of the western people by way of giving them around 160 acres of public land. Also, as a payback, these western people gave the government a minimal fee. These people should live in that land alloted for a period of five years and after that only, the ownership of the land will be given back to them solely.

Construction of the Transcontinental Railroad

The first transcontinental railroad was constructed in US in between the years 1863 and 1869. It was constructed for joining and making a connection between the east US and the west US. In the 19th century US, this was the major technological achievement. It was built by own hands of people, and not with the help of any equipment. This railroad permits very rural areas as well as areas not explored till date reachable to others, transportation improvements, migrating and settling in these areas etc.
